ATLANTA, Sept. 27 (UPI) -- Three players had three RBI Wednesday night as Atlanta pounded the New York Mets, 13-1.
Brian McCann had two runs, three hits, including a two-run homer, and three RBI; Jeff Francoeur had three runs, two hits, including a solo home run, and three RBI; Chipper Jones had one run, two hits, including a two-run homer, and three RBI; Ryan Longerhans had two hits and one RBI; and Scott Thorman hit a solo home run for the Braves (77-81), who have split their last six games.
Winner Tim Hudson (13-12) scattered a run and four hits over six innings with three walks and two strikeouts.
Shawn Green hit an RBI ground out for the lone run; and Endy Chavez had two of the six hits for the Mets (93-65), who have a four-game losing streak.
Losing pitcher Pedro Martinez (9-8) gave up eight hits and seven runs in 2 2/3 innings.
